On March 6, it was announced that the disciplinary committee of the Gymnastics Ethics Foundation, affiliated with the International Gymnastics Federation, decided to suspend Viner for two years. The sanctions will come into effect the day after the suspension imposed on them due to the situation in Ukraine is lifted from Russian athletes.
The reason for this decision was public statements made by Wiener after the Russian gymnasts failed to win a gold medal at the Tokyo Summer Olympics, was offensive and violated the FIG code of ethics, and Russian Natalya Kuzmina was excluded from the election. To the FIG Rhythmic Gymnastics Technical Committee.
